Transaction 777bf16fe66bb5f91cd363f2ee8a91cd62a17153467ebe21c05ed4db58c018a2

1 Input
2 Outputs
  • 777bf16fe66bb5f91cd363f2ee8a91cd62a17153467ebe21c05ed4db58c018a2:0
  • value  150000000
    address  1DX3hnrGDqSGTEg4AvFy1GDpfUAhmBDtwS
  • 777bf16fe66bb5f91cd363f2ee8a91cd62a17153467ebe21c05ed4db58c018a2:1
  • value  149990000
    address  1MCDtyftjrG933ZLJBfM6U1A2JKdfoqTaT